Underwater Optical Communications

    Radio Frequency waves cannot penetrate seawater. To provide communications between underwater vehicles, sensors, and submarines we have been building high bandwidth, short range underwater optical communication systems using blue lasers and light emitting diodes and advanced error correction techniques. 

Amorphous Semiconducting Oxides

 Amorphous Oxide Semiconductors have electron mobilites that are 10 to 100 times faster than amorphous silicon. This creates the possibilites of creating Oxide electronics that can be placed on diverse substrates such as Glass, plastics and even paper. The first commercial applications of this technology will be in Active Matrix Displays.
